I have never needed to rely on a home cleaning business until recently. Clean hands was available when I called and Raquel squeezed me into their schedule. The service was acceptable and did most of what was required for my check out. There were a couple of surfaces upon inspection I needed to re do because it wasn’t up to par. They will tell you what will be cleaned and what they won’t clean(ie: outside windows on a second story building, outside light fixtures, etc.). The prices they charged seem way too expensive for what was done. There was no flexibility in price and was charged one flat fee based on the size of the house. They did a nice job on the shower stall and tackled the almost impossible hard water stains. This home did not have a water softener and made it quite difficult to manage the hard water stains on the counter surfaces. The floors were done well and the blinds were cleaned. They cleaned underneath the kitchen appliances and the top of the cupboard ledge. I had already cleaned the interior of the appliances so I can’t really rate this area. One thing I wasn’t very happy about was the large tire impression left in the front yard that I had to fix. I had been raining heavily that day and one of the cleaning people that backed out from the driveway left a deep hole in the front yard. I had already spent hours weeding and raking the stones in the yard. If I left the tire print the way it was, I would have surely been charged for landscaping services to fix it. When I had arrived to lock up the house, I watched one of the worker’s struggle out the garage entry door to dump the mop water outside. I didn’t see it until later but the door knob made contact with the wall and left a small hole that needed to be repaired. Not a big deal but it was something that I needed to fix. I am not a big fan of cleaning services because most of what was done, I can do. Having worked with a real estate company, that was one of the hoops they made us jump to go through the final stages of the rental process. It’s done and I am glad.
